Can we install with Carpet with underfloor heating?

Underfloor heating can be used, and adapted, for the majority of floor finishes, however carpet is one floor type we avoid.

Using carpet with underfloor heating is not a no go, and you can adapt the system for it; using a carpet and underlay of less than 2tog and the under tile mat with a 10mm latex self leveller, for example. The issue with carpet is it keeps out what you want most from your underfloor heating, heat. Carpet is a great insulator and is perfect for keeping the cold out of your room, and feels great on your feet, but with underfloor heating it causes your system to become very inefficient and ineffective.

While it can be used, we would advise not so you can enjoy the true benefits of underfloor heating.
